armsr: armv8: enable KVM host
authorMathew McBride <matt@traverse.com.au>
Tue, 20 Jun 2023 01:23:17 +0000 (01:23 +0000)
committerHauke Mehrtens <hauke@hauke-m.de>
Sat, 19 Aug 2023 13:11:55 +0000 (15:11 +0200)
x86/64 enables support for KVM so I can't see a reason why
not on armsr/armv8 as well.

Arm CPU errata workaround items related to virtualization
are also enabled by this change.

Signed-off-by: Mathew McBride <matt@traverse.com.au>
(23.05/5.15 version of commit e505873e65f72b5e89c136dbb61d992a2219b6eb)

target/linux/armsr/armv8/config-5.15

index a6ec43e3f10d4379ca1498a01f9274542c33d025..61641e1d3f4d61c9df1534fb43a477f2b2c2fb70 100644 (file)
@@ -1,4 +1,5 @@
 CONFIG_64BIT=y
+CONFIG_AMPERE_ERRATUM_AC03_CPU_38=y
 CONFIG_ARCH_HISI=y
 CONFIG_ARCH_INTEL_SOCFPGA=y
 CONFIG_ARCH_LAYERSCAPE=y
@@ -38,6 +39,7 @@ CONFIG_ARM64_ERRATUM_2051678=y
 CONFIG_ARM64_ERRATUM_2054223=y
 CONFIG_ARM64_ERRATUM_2067961=y
 CONFIG_ARM64_ERRATUM_2077057=y
+CONFIG_ARM64_ERRATUM_2441007=y
 CONFIG_ARM64_ERRATUM_2441009=y
 CONFIG_ARM64_ERRATUM_2457168=y
 CONFIG_ARM64_ERRATUM_2658417=y
@@ -46,6 +48,7 @@ CONFIG_ARM64_ERRATUM_824069=y
 CONFIG_ARM64_ERRATUM_826319=y
 CONFIG_ARM64_ERRATUM_827319=y
 CONFIG_ARM64_ERRATUM_832075=y
+CONFIG_ARM64_ERRATUM_834220=y
 CONFIG_ARM64_ERRATUM_843419=y
 CONFIG_ARM64_ERRATUM_845719=y
 CONFIG_ARM64_HW_AFDBM=y
@@ -260,6 +263,7 @@ CONFIG_IOMMU_SUPPORT=y
 # CONFIG_K3_DMA is not set
 CONFIG_KCMP=y
 # CONFIG_KEYBOARD_SUN4I_LRADC is not set
+CONFIG_KVM=y
 CONFIG_LCD_CLASS_DEVICE=m
 # CONFIG_LCD_PLATFORM is not set
 # CONFIG_MAILBOX_TEST is not set
@@ -306,6 +310,7 @@ CONFIG_NO_HZ=y
 CONFIG_NO_HZ_COMMON=y
 CONFIG_NO_HZ_IDLE=y
 CONFIG_NR_CPUS=64
+# CONFIG_NVHE_EL2_DEBUG is not set
 CONFIG_NVIDIA_CARMEL_CNP_ERRATUM=y
 # CONFIG_NVMEM_IMX_IIM is not set
 CONFIG_NVMEM_IMX_OCOTP=y
@@ -518,6 +523,7 @@ CONFIG_VIDEOMODE_HELPERS=y
 # CONFIG_VIDEO_SUN6I_CSI is not set
 CONFIG_VIRTIO_DMA_SHARED_BUFFER=y
 # CONFIG_VIRTIO_IOMMU is not set
+CONFIG_VIRTUALIZATION=y
 CONFIG_VMAP_STACK=y
 CONFIG_WDAT_WDT=y
 # CONFIG_XILINX_AMS is not set